The Importance Of Lyophilization Training

Lyophilization, also known as freeze-drying, is a crucial process used in various industries such as pharmaceuticals, food, and cosmetics. It involves removing water from products by freezing them and then drying them under a vacuum. This process helps in preserving the product’s shelf life and maintaining its integrity.

Given the complexity and importance of lyophilization, it is essential for professionals in these industries to undergo proper training to ensure the success of the process. Let’s delve deeper into the importance of lyophilization training and how it can benefit individuals and organizations.

**2. Ensuring Product Quality**

One of the primary reasons for undergoing lyophilization training is to ensure the quality of the final product. Improperly dried products can lead to degradation, loss of efficacy, and reduced shelf life. By undergoing training, professionals learn how to optimize the lyophilization process to maintain product quality and integrity. This is crucial in industries such as pharmaceuticals, where product efficacy and safety are of utmost importance.
